Lot Details

Description

Dial: black

Caliber: cal. GUB 39 automatic, 51 jewels

Movement number: 16’738

Case: 18k pink gold, sapphire crystal display back secured by five screws

Case number: 0’068

Closure: 18k pink gold Glashutte Original buckle

Size: 39 mm diameter

Signed: case, dial and movement

Box: no

Papers: no

Weight: approximately 113.1 g

In today's day and age, it has become harder to find watch manufacturers that prioritize their historic and geographic legacy rather than outsource production: Glashütte Original is one of those few. 


The brand continuously produces around 95% of their watches in Glashütte, Germany. Because of this, they meet the threshold to brandish the city's name in their title. Even though the brand was acquired by The Swatch Group in 2000, the manufacturer has stuck with their roots and continued to excel in producing high quality watches that embody German craftsmanship and engineering.
